Full Lineup Announced for 2018 Chicago Blues Festival in Millennium Park
by Macon Prickett - Mar 27, 2018


Experience Chicago's blues music legacy at the 35th Annual Chicago Blues Festival happening June 8-10 in Millennium Park (201 E. Randolph St.). The Blues Festival will spotlight the great Chicago-born music tradition with live performances by the genre's leading artists at Millennium Park's Jay Pritzker Pavilion, the city's premier outdoor music venue. The previously announced headliners include: Corey Dennison Band; Mississippi Heat with Billy Flynn and Giles Corey; Special Tribute to Bob Koester and the 65th Anniversary of Delmark Records; Selwyn Birchwood; Willie Clayton; Little Walter Tribute; Fantastic Negrito, Kenny Neal and Mavis Staples.

Signature Theatre Announces Cast And Creative Team For Annie Baker's JOHN
by Stephi Wild - Mar 5, 2018


Signature Theatre announces the full cast and creative team for the DC premiere of Annie Baker's John, directed by Signature Theatre Director of New Work Joe Calarco (Signature's The Gulf, Jesus Christ Superstar). Elias and Jenny, a young Brooklyn couple, escape on a much-needed getaway to a cozy bed-and-breakfast in Gettysburg, Pennsylvania. However, under the watchful eye of the cheery, if slightly off, innkeeper, a ghost seems to haunt their crumbling relationship. Annie Baker's John was called "so good on so many levels that it casts a unique and brilliant light' by The New Yorker. John will run April 3 - April 29 in Signature Theatre's MAX Theatre.

Blue Moon Mexican Cafe Presents FRENCH COOKIN'
by Julie Musbach - Jan 31, 2018


Blue Moon Cafe Entertainment presents FRENCH COOKIN'! A regular act at Lucille's Grill / B.B. King's Club in Times Square since its inception, and going back as far as Dan Lynch Blues Bar, and The Lone Star Cafe days, French Cookin' is a 2014 inductee into the New York Blues Hall Of Fame. French Cookin' plays all styles of the Blues; Delta, Chicago, New Orleans Second Line, Texas Swing, and more, plus original material written by our singer/guitarist/band leader, Doc French.
